New Zealand Telecom Warning Notice

Use of pulse dialing, when this equipment is connected to the same

line as other equipment, may give rise to ‘bell tinkle’ or noise and may

also cause a false answer condition. Should such problems occur, the

user should NOT contact the Telecom Faults Service.
The preferred method of dialing is to use DTMF tones, as this is faster

than pulse (decadic) dialing and is readily available on almost all New

Zealand telephone exchanges.

Warning Notice: No '111' or other calls can be made from this device

during a mains power failure.

International Modem Restrictions

Some dialing and answering defaults and restrictions may vary for

international modems. Changing settings may cause a modem to

become non-compliant with national telecom requirements in specific

countries. Also note that some software packages may have features

or lack restrictions that may cause the modem to become non-

compliant.
